Detroit in harsh spotlight

May 11, 2008

DETROIT (AP) — As she hurried to join fellow City Council members in a closed session regarding Detroit Mayor Kwame Kilpatrick and a publicly embarrassing text-messaging sex scandal, Martha Reeves flashed a smile born mostly of exasperation.

‘‘I want to get back to the tunnel, the Livernois median. I think we should get back to Council business,’’ the former lead singer of Motown’s Martha and the Vandellas told reporters.

Reeves is one of nine members of a weary and frustrated Council that has become a major player — along with the mayor, his posse of lawyers, prosecutors and even judges — in a scandal that has caught nearly all aspects of city business in its expanding web.

Among the weighty issues facing the Council is whether to continue efforts to remove Kilpatrick, who is facing eight felony charges.
